AMEND E-COMMERCE RULES -PROPOSED BY CENTRE!!!

The Central government proposed amendments to the consumer protection (e-commerce) Rules, 2020 which recommended by a parliamentary panel headed by Member of parliament by Partap Singh Bajwa.

The new draft rules came out because of e-commerce giants such as Filpkart and Amazon are being investigated for alleged abuse of market dominance and give preferential treatment to sellers of indirect stakes.

NEW DRAFT RULES:-

This proposed changes aim to tighten the existing regulatory regime and make e-commerce companies more accountable.


1) Mandatory registration of e-commerce entities.
2) Disclosure regarding cross-selling of goods
3) Prohibition of mis-selling of goods
4) Ban on fraud flash sales.
5) Grievance Redressal Mechanism
6) Prevention of preferential treatment
7) Non-discrimination between imported and domestic goods.
8) Prevention of abuse of dominant position
9) Final liability to rest on the e-commerce platforms


These amendents shall ensure more accountability for e-commerce companies.
